Frequently Asked Questions about Central Village

How much are Studio apartments in Central Village?

There are currently 14 Studio Apartments in Central Village with rent ranges from $1,050 to $2,025 with an average price of $1,370.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Central Village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Central Village ranges from $1,130 to $3,370 with an average monthly rent of $1,697.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Central Village c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Central Village range from $1,285 to $3,064.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,076.

How expensive are Central Village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 20 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Central Village on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,215 to $3,705 - averaging $2,196 for the location.
